To open the Source Manager, on the References tab, in the Citations & Bibliography group, click the Manage Sources button: In the Source Manager dialog box: In the Search field, search a source you need by any information you have: by some letters, words of the title, author, by year, etc. In the drop-down list at the upper right corner, change ... Importing References. Open Microsoft Word. Click the References tab on the ribbon. Click the Manage Sources button. In the Source Manager window, click Browse. In the Open Source List window, navigate to the Sources.xml file (this file may be on a flash drive, CD, etc.) Double-click on the Sources.xml file to import the saved sources to ... ….

Select Add New Source from the drop-down menu.Step 1: Open up a Microsoft Word document, and click on references. You will see an area that says citations and bibliography. Step 2: Click on the style button. Please select the style (APA, MLA, Turabian) that you will be using to write the paper. Step 3: Click on Manage Sources. A screen that says "Source Manager" should appear.
